OK. I have just gone in my mail and found the first message was read out for me. However, I was not sure that it was all read so I did a quick two-finger flick upstarting a little above the Home button and ensured I'd read it all. As soon as I knew I had, I placed two fingers on the centre of the screen, slightly apart, and the speech stopped.

I could then locate the delete button just above and slightly right of the home button and I was ready placed in the next message for reading.

Now the problems start when it isn't so simple. When you first go into mail you are placed in the list of messages. I often touch the screen to locate the first of these before double tapping. I find this is best achieved by locating the back button, always on the left, about a third down on the screen, then flicking right until I get that first message. This can be about four flicks from the left as I listen to "Inbox whatever it is", Edit, Serach and then reach the first message. When you get to grips with this you can probably find the first message without those flicks.

It shouldn't be a problem with the email provider. Are we talking about the 
native email client app? Is she seeing her list of messages in the in box? If 
so then double tapping on a message should bring up the message and a two 
finger swipe up should read the body of the message from the top. When she 
explores the screen after double tapping on a message what does she see?

Containers might help navigate a bit, but if a two finger swipe up doesn't read 
the body of the message then there are bigger problems then will be addressed 
by containers. Are we talking about an iPhone or an iPad?
